#450452 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#450452 is composed of 27.1% red, 1.6%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.9% cyan, 95.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 290 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 16.9%. #450452 color hex could be obtained by blending #8a08a4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#450452

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060007 is the darkest color, while #fdf3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#450452

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2d282e is the less saturated color, while #470155 is the most saturated one.
